Featured Neighborhoods in Cleveland, TN
Cleveland is composed of several distinct neighborhoods, each with its own character and advantages. Choosing the right neighborhood is a crucial part of the home-buying process. Let's explore some of the most popular:
Historic Downtown Cleveland
Downtown Cleveland is the heart of the city, offering a vibrant urban lifestyle. Here, you'll find historic homes, trendy lofts, and easy access to shops, restaurants, and cultural attractions. The area is known for its walkability and community events. However, parking can be limited, and property prices tend to be higher compared to suburban areas.
North Cleveland
North Cleveland is a family-friendly area with well-regarded schools and a mix of housing options, including single-family homes and new developments. The neighborhood is known for its quiet streets and proximity to parks and recreational facilities. In our experience, North Cleveland is highly sought after due to its excellent schools and family-oriented atmosphere.
South Cleveland
South Cleveland offers a more rural feel, with larger lots and a mix of housing styles. It's a great option for those seeking more space and privacy. The area is also close to outdoor attractions like the Cherokee National Forest. Commute times to downtown Cleveland may be longer from this area.

Finding the Right Home: A Step-by-Step Guide
Navigating the home-buying process can seem daunting, but breaking it down into steps makes it more manageable. Here's a step-by-step guide to help you find the right home in Cleveland, TN:
Step 1: Get Pre-Approved for a Mortgage
Before you start seriously looking at homes, it's essential to get pre-approved for a mortgage. This involves meeting with a lender and providing financial documentation to determine how much you can borrow. Pre-approval gives you a clear budget and demonstrates to sellers that you're a serious buyer. In our testing, we've found that buyers with pre-approval often have a competitive edge in bidding situations.
Step 2: Define Your Needs and Wants
Make a list of your must-have and nice-to-have features in a home. Consider factors like size, number of bedrooms and bathrooms, location, school district, and amenities. Prioritizing your needs and wants helps you narrow down your search and avoid wasting time on unsuitable properties. Our analysis shows that buyers who clearly define their criteria are more satisfied with their final purchase.
Step 3: Work with a Local Real Estate Agent
A local real estate agent can be an invaluable resource. They have expertise in the Cleveland, TN market, access to listings, and negotiation skills. An agent can help you find properties that match your criteria, schedule showings, and guide you through the offer process. According to the National Association of Realtors, buyers who use agents are more likely to find a home that meets their needs.
Step 4: Start Your Home Search
Use online resources, your agent's listings, and drive around neighborhoods to find potential homes. Attend open houses and schedule showings to view properties in person. Pay attention to the condition of the home, its layout, and its surroundings. Don't be afraid to ask questions and take notes during showings. — High School Football Playoffs: Your Ultimate Guide
Step 5: Make an Offer
Once you've found a home you love, your agent will help you prepare an offer. This involves determining the price you're willing to pay and any contingencies you want to include (such as a home inspection). Your agent will present the offer to the seller, who may accept, reject, or counter it. Negotiation is a common part of the process.
Step 6: Home Inspection and Appraisal
If your offer is accepted, you'll typically have a home inspection performed to identify any potential issues. You'll also need to have the property appraised to ensure its value aligns with the purchase price. These steps protect your investment and can uncover problems you may not have noticed during showings.
Step 7: Close the Deal
Once the inspection and appraisal are complete and any issues are resolved, you'll move towards closing. This involves signing paperwork, transferring funds, and officially taking ownership of the property. Your agent, lender, and attorney will guide you through this final step.

What are some popular amenities and attractions in Cleveland, TN?
Cleveland, TN, offers a variety of amenities and attractions, including parks, museums, restaurants, and shopping centers. Popular spots include the Museum Center at 5ive Points, Red Clay State Historic Park, and the downtown area. The city also hosts several community events throughout the year.
